Multiple on-board interfaces allow you to use your scanner with different host
systems. To ensure compatibility with emerging standards, the Symbol M2000
supports the GS1 DataBar (formerly RSS) symboloby and 14-digit Global Trade Item
Number (GTIN) bar codes.
FEATURES
- Reads 1-D, PDF417 and Composite UCC/EAN
and GS1 DataBar (formerly RSS) bar code symbologies
Capture more data and "future-proof" your investment.
- Cyclone uses the latest, brightest
visible laser diode technology
Scanner is easy to aim, even in brightest sunlight.
- Scan pattern switches and mode indicator
LEDs are top-mounted for easy viewing
Switching scan patterns is easy and convenient for operations with a mix of
applications, bar codes and merchandise.
- Handheld or hands-free operation
Operators can scan heavy and bulky items without lifting them onto the
checkstand; scan smaller items without lifting the scanner.
- Built-in, adjustable stand
Operators adjust the Cyclone to their preference to optimize efficiency for
maximum throughput.
PERFORMANCE CHARACTERISTICS
- Decode capability - 1D/PDF417, See
data sheet for full list of supported symbologies
- Interfaces supported - IBM, Keyboard
wedge, RS-232, Synapse, USB, Wand
- Minimum resolution - 25%
minimum reflectance (1-D); 35% minimum reflectance (PDF)
- Scan pattern - Omni-directional,
Rastering, Single line, Semi-omni-directional
- Technology - Laser
